Chapter 53 contains no general accessory dwelling unit authorization. Accessory structures in residential districts are limited to rear yards, may not exceed the primary structure height or 20 feet, may not exceed half the principal structure's square footage in aggregate, and district use lists limit dwellings to the principal uses stated (Secs. 53-33(r), 53-33(o)). Some districts expressly bar accessory dwelling use (Sec. 53-632(2)e for HS). Second floor residential is permitted by right in NC and CC (Secs. 53-665, 53-672).
